West Ham United fans have taken to Twitter this evening as the club’s players head away to Spain for a warm-weather training camp ahead of a free weekend.
The disdain of the Claret & Blue Army centres around the fact that the Hammers would be in Emirates FA Cup fifth-round action this weekend, had they been able to overcome Sky Bet League One basement boys AFC Wimbledon.
Instead, they were dumped out of the world’s oldest football competition with an embarrassing 4-2 defeat at the Cherry Red Records Stadium in the fourth round in late January.
Some Hammers are not happy that the shambolic result meant that the team gets a “nice holiday” away in Spain. Although it must be noted that the Irons have held league leaders Liverpool to a draw and earned a credible Premier League point at Crystal Palace since then.
